As CEO Salaries Skyrocket More Than 25%, Financial Security Is Wavering For Workers

Allwork

Within a year during the pandemic, on average CEOs gained “29% raises while their median worker pay fell by 2%,” the Institute for Policy Studies (IPS) found. By 2021, chief executives at companies with the lowest-paid staff made an average of $10.6 million salaries while the median worker received $23,968, the report revealed. .

How Women Are Rising in Business

Success

The women surveyed in Guidant’s “ 2023 Small Business Trends ” report were primarily motivated to become entrepreneurs due to being “ready to be their own boss” (28%) and “[dissatisfied] with corporate America” (23%), with only 13% seeking to pursue their passions.
